The following table gives the marks scored by 100 students in an entrance examination. Marks:  0-10    10-20  20-30  30-40  40-50  50-60  60-70  70-80 No. of Students (Frequency): 4  10  16  22  20  18  8  2 Represent this data in the form of a histogram.
